Start learning 50% faster. Sign in nowThe Union Cabinet has given approval for payment of Productivity Linked Bonus to railway employees for the financial year 2021-22. This year also, PLB amount equivalent to 78 days wages has been paid to about 11.27 lakh non-gazetted Railway employees. The maximum amount payable per eligible railway employee is Rs. 17,951/- for 78 days. The above amount has been paid to various categories viz. Track maintainers, Drivers & Guards, Station masters, Supervisors, Technician, Technician Helper, controller, Pointsmen, Ministerial staff & other Group ‘C’ staff.The financial implication of payment of 78 days PLB to railway employees has been estimated to be Rs. 1832.09 crore.
